Hereford FC v Boston United LIVE minute by minute updates

Our live feed has now finished.

  • HIGHLIGHTS
  • 4) Kelsey Mooney founds space inside the Hereford box and meets a cross but can only side his headed effort wide.
  • 6) Jason Cowley beats the last man but goalkeeper Gregory is out quickly and saves from close range with his legs.
  • 16) A ball into the Hereford box bounces over Ceesay into the path of Jai Rowe who drives his low effort just wide.
  • 29) Cowley picks out the run of Andy Williams who surges in on goal before seeing his low effort saved at close range by goalkeeper Gregory.
  • 39) Teixeira finds Cowley who squares inside the box for Williams, but the ball just evades the marksman.
  • 45) Cameron finds Williams inside the box who chips the ball goalward and against the post.
  • Hereford 0 Boston United 1
  • 51) Hereford fail to clear the ball inside their box and capitalises Jordan Richards sweeping the ball home.
  • 53) Babos' low cross comes out to Cowley in space who sends his effort over. It may have bobbled before the striker hit the ball.
  • Hereford 0 Boston United 2
  • 65) A quick Boston attack results in a ball in for Jai Rowe who fires low and across Pond into the net.
  • 69) Jid Okeke with a surging run to the byline which takes a deflection before Gregory has to prevent the ball from dipping under his bar.
  • 70) Babos' corner into a crowd of players finds Ceesay at the back post who sends his effort inches wide.

  • PRE-MATCH
  • HEREFORD host Boston United in the final day of the National League North season.
  • Paul Caddis' side come into the final game of the season three points outside the play-off positions.
  • The Bulls need to beat Boston United 11-0 and then hope that both South Shields and Spennymoor both lose.
  • Boston are in 7th position and know that a win at Hereford will secure their play-off spot.
  • However, a draw or Hereford win could see them drop out or stay in the play-offs depending on other results.
  • Whatever today's result Hereford have improved on last season.
  • The Bulls finished in 16th last year with 55 points from their 46 games.
  • This season Hereford have accumulated 69 points from 45 games so far.
  • Last season Kidderminster went up through the play-offs after finishing on 69 points.
